Become a vital part of a hospital team in Falmouth, MA as an experienced Computed Tomography (CT) Technologist. You will perform CT procedures, operate the CT console and peripheral equipment, position and prepare patients, assist with contrast administration when sanctioned, evaluate image quality, maintain radiology records, and follow department policies, radiation safety, infection control, and patient confidentiality standards. You will coordinate work to ensure timely completion of studies and participate in continuing education as required by ARRT and Massachusetts licensing.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Graduation from an AMA- or JRCERT-accredited Radiography program.
  • Registration by the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T).
  • Valid Massachusetts state license in Radiation Control.
  • Certification from an accredited CT program or current ARRT (CT) registration.
  • Current BLS certification.
  • Experience: 3 years as a Radiologic Technologist OR 1 year CT technologist experience within the last 5 years.
  • Ability to read, write, and communicate in English.
